
From GameWatcher: "Publisher and developer Nightdive Studios has spent the last four years working on the System Shock remaster, aiming to offer fans a reimagining of the classic immersive sim for modern audiences.
The most recent monthly Kickstarter updates focused on releasing a backer demo alongside a look at some new concept art. While some backers are showing signs of weariness, the developer told us that work on the game is coming along nicely."
